摘 要: | 针对注射成型微透镜特征阵列的复制程度和成型异性,以具有微透镜阵列特征的薄壁导光板为例,运用数值模拟和正交试验法对其进行了翘曲分析。结果表明,中间区域的微透镜特征表现出沿轮廓曲线均匀缩小的变形趋势,而边侧微透镜特征表现出向中心偏移的变形趋势;依据不同的复制程度特征指标,发现熔体温度、进胶流率和模具温度对微透镜特征阵列的复制程度影响较大。

Abstract: | For replication fidelity and anisotropic formation of microlens feature array during injection molding processes, a thin-walled light guide panel with a microlens feature array was taken as an example to perform a warpage analysis by using numerical simulation and orthogonal experiment methods. The results indicated that the deformation trend of microlens features in the middle region exhibit a homogeneous decrease along the contour curve, whereas the deformation tendency of the side microlens features presented a deviation toward the center. According to the different replication characteristics, the melt temperature, flow rate and mold temperature were found to have a great effect on the reproduction fidelity of microlens feature array. |
